Supply Chain & Revenue Models

  1. Raw Material Sourcing:

    Procurement of high-quality aluminum, tempered glass, silicone seals, and LED chips from global suppliers.

  2. Manufacturing & Assembly:

    Integration of waterproof enclosures, thermal management, and electronic components, often leveraging automation for quality consistency.

  3. Distribution & Logistics:

    Multi-channel distribution including direct sales, OEM partnerships, and online marketplaces, optimized for regional reach.

  4. End-User Delivery & Lifecycle Services:

    Installation, commissioning, maintenance, and retrofit services generate recurring revenue streams.

Digital Transformation & Cross-Industry Synergies

Digitalization is reshaping the waterproof lighting landscape through system integration, interoperability standards, and data-driven insights. Key trends include:

  • Smart Lighting & IoT Integration:

    Enabling remote control, adaptive lighting, and predictive maintenance, reducing operational costs.

  • Standards & Protocols:

    Adoption of industry standards like DALI, Zigbee, and Bluetooth Mesh ensures interoperability across devices and platforms.

  • Cross-Industry Collaborations:

    Partnerships between lighting manufacturers, IoT platform providers, and urban planners accelerate deployment of intelligent outdoor lighting systems.

Cost Structures, Pricing Strategies, and Risk Factors

Major cost components include raw materials (~40%), manufacturing (~25%), R&D (~10%), distribution (~10%), and after-sales services (~15%). The premium pricing of high-end waterproof fixtures reflects technological sophistication and certification costs.

Pricing strategies focus on value-based models, with tiered offerings for basic, mid-range, and premium segments. Volume discounts and long-term service contracts are common revenue enhancers.

Key risk factors encompass:

  • Regulatory & Certification Challenges:

    Stringent standards may delay product launches or increase compliance costs.

  • Cybersecurity Concerns:

    IoT-enabled systems are vulnerable to hacking, necessitating robust security protocols.

  • Supply Chain Disruptions:

    Geopolitical tensions and raw material shortages could impact production costs and timelines.

  • Market Saturation & Competition:

    Intense rivalry may pressure margins and necessitate continuous innovation.
